                             TY PEEPLES
                             OF  |  GEORGIA  |  FR.
                             A 20th-round MLB Draft selection out of high school by the Toronto Blue Jays in 2025, Peeples opted to attend Georgia, where
                             he helped the Bulldogs emerge as a national power. Playing a reserve role in his first 21 games, he reached base at a .500 clip
                             and scored eight times, knocking his first collegiate hit on March 22 at Texas A&M. A Perfect Game All-American at Franklin
                             County High School, Peeples set the Georgia state record with 142 career walks.



                             MIKEY RAGUSA
                             RHP  |  NORTH CAROLINA STATE  |  FR.
                             A highly-touted recruit out of Cardinal Gibbons High School in Florida, Ragusa was ranked by Perfect Game as the No. 5 right-
                             handed pitching recruit and No. 30 overall recruit in the 2025 high school class. He was used sparingly in his freshman season
                             at NC State, pitching to a 2.25 ERA. He made scoreless relief outings against Virginia Tech on April 26 and against East Carolina
                             two days later.


                             KAYSEN RAINERI

                             RHP  |  TEXAS TECH  |  SO.
                             Raineri played his freshman season at Hawaii, pitching sparingly under former Chatham manager Rich Hill, before transferring
                             to Texas Tech for 2026. He punched out 24 in his first 20 innings with the Red Raiders. A native of Temecula, California, Raineri
                             has also pitched in both the Northwoods League and West Coast League, compiling a 2.64 ERA over the last two summers. 





                             KORBIN REYNOLDS
                             C  |  VANDERBILT  |  FR.

                             Reynolds, a Tennessee native, entered his freshman season at Vanderbilt as the primary backstop for the Commodores. Starting
                             38 of his first 40 collegiate games, Reynolds clubbed five home runs and drove in 21 runs in that span. His first collegiate hit —
                             against Marist on Feb. 20 — left the yard and 10 of his first 26 hits went for extra bases. Reynolds is a former top-50 catcher
                             recruit nationally in the high school class of 2025.



                             ADRIAN RODRIGUEZ
                             IF  |  TEXAS  |  SO.

                             A do-it-all infielder for Texas, Rodriguez made Perfect Game’s First-Team All-America list in 2025 after he hit .313 with seven
                             home runs and 23 RBIs in 2025. He returned in 2026, hitting .257 in his first 35 games for the Longhorns — all starts, headlined
                             by a three-hit, three-RBI day in a win over Vanderbilt on April 24. A native of Flower Mound, Texas, he also leads all Texas players
                             with 26 stolen bases over the past two seasons.



                             RUSS SMITH
                             RHP  |  DALLAS BAPTIST  |  SO.

                             Used both as a starter and long reliever during his sophomore season at Dallas Baptist, Smith struck out 43 in his first 41.2 innings
                             with the Patriots. He made the jump to DBU after a freshman season at Cowley College in Kansas. Smith earned honorable
                             mention all-conference honors in 2025 after compiling a 9-1 record and a 3.60 ERA, striking out 71 hitters and walking only 14.
